FAQ Section 1. Can you flip the camera in the FullVUE® Screen? - At this time you cannot flip the image from the FullVUE® camera. Please check back with our website for the latest information. 2. Can I turn the display off and use the FullVUE® as a mirror? - Yes! Simply tap the bottom button 1 time ( 2 times if you have the time stamp screen) and the mirror will function as a traditional mirror.
